probably so the sticks stack. Ive seen some pics of guys countersinking the bolt heads into the button and others drilling a hole into the back of the next stick for the bolt head to fit into like lone wolf sticks

It depends on the cleat you're using. If I recall correctly the cleats I got off Amazon worked with the 1/4-20 bolts. There's a write up on the forum somewhere that says what bolts to use.
grade 8 or stronger for anything life-supporting. (the ones with 6 lines on the end)
